The young fawns are frolicking on the lawn, nipping and jumping while they are at play and the doe, with her patience, watches on. If I remain quiet then they may stay. I just love this view from my deck today. The summer will be gone too soon I fear and with it will go my visiting deer. Francine Roberts 26/08/2011 for Dr. Rams "Rhyme Royal" contest picture attached
